MassPay Holdings LLC, a global payout orchestration platform, and Coinbase, the world’s leading regulated cryptocurrency exchange, announced a strategic partnership to bring stablecoin-powered cross-border payout capabilities to businesses worldwide.
The partnership combines MassPay’s single-API global payout network – covering 180 countries across bank transfer, mobile wallet, and digital asset rails – with Coinbase’s regulated digital asset infrastructure, institutional-grade safeguarding of digital assets, and extensive global licensing footprint. Together, they enable enterprise customers to move seamlessly between fiat currency, USDC, and other digital assets without managing separate crypto infrastructure.

Bridging Fiat and Digital Assets at Scale
Corporate customers, marketplaces, and platforms using MassPay can now fund disbursements in USD – converting to USDC via Coinbase – or deposit USDC directly, then pay recipients in USDC, other digital assets, or local fiat currency. Coinbase’s APIs handle wallet infrastructure, custody, and the onchain layer; MassPay handles last-mile payout orchestration globally.
The integration eliminates the operational complexity of managing stablecoin onramps, wallet infrastructure, liquidity, and regulatory requirements independently – giving enterprises a single, unified platform to move money and pay anyone, anywhere.
